Local tips
- Visit during early morning or late afternoon for the best lighting and fewer crowds.
- Wear sturdy hiking boots, as the trails can be rugged and steep.
- Bring a camera to capture the stunning views and diverse wildlife.
- Consider visiting in spring for blooming wildflowers or in autumn for stunning foliage.
- Check local weather conditions before your visit, as they can change rapidly in the mountains.
